A remote AI engineer for oil and gas is a technical expert who applies advanced machine learning to domain-specific data—geological, seismic, SCADA—delivering business-critical insights while working flexibly from anywhere.
Unlike generic AI engineers, these professionals blend Python, machine learning frameworks, and deep oilfield context to tackle asset management, drilling analytics, and regulatory compliance. Their knowledge spans data formats like LAS, SEG-Y, and real-time sensor data.

How much does a remote AI engineer for oil and gas cost?Hourly rates range from $100–$200+ in the US/EU, and $40–$90 for vetted specialists offshore (LATAM/Eastern Europe), depending on experience and domain fluency.
What is the optimal team structure for AI in oil & gas?The minimum is 1–2 domain-expert AI/ML engineers, 1 data engineer (oil & gas data), a product owner with petroleum background, and QA/test resources.
Why is it so hard to find hybrid AI/petroleum talent?True hybrid engineers who understand both deep learning and subsurface workflows are rare and in high demand, leading to scarcity and premium rates.
What technical skills are non-negotiable for oil & gas AI roles?Essential requirements include proficiency with sector data formats (LAS, SEG-Y, SCADA), strong Python/ML stack, production deployment, and strict adherence to regulatory workflows.
Buy vs. Build vs. Hire: When is each strategy best?Buy for fast, standardized needs. Build for custom, proprietary innovation. Hire for pilot/Poc or quick scale—remotely or via specialized agencies.
How do you screen AI candidates for oil & gas domain fluency?Ask about project experience with oil & gas data formats, collaboration with geoscientists, production ML deployment, and prior compliance/security alignment.
What are the biggest risks in remote AI hiring for oil & gas?Risks include collaboration friction, regulatory or data privacy non-compliance, and lengthy onboarding for domain training.
How can agencies help reduce time-to-value in AI talent sourcing?Top agencies deliver AI engineers already versed in petroleum/energy data, shortening the ramp-up and aligning faster to project goals.
Where is the best value for contracting remote AI engineers?LATAM and Eastern Europe offer strong domain crossover, English-fluent engineers, and about 30–60% cost savings compared to North America or Western Europe.
What’s the most common hiring mistake in oil & gas AI projects?Overweighting pure technical skills and underestimating petroleum data context—leading to misfit models and failed pilots.
